万年素人からHackerへの道

万年素人がHackerになれるまで殴り書きするぜ。

  • ・資産運用おすすめ
    10万円は1000円くらい利益
    資産運用ブログ アセマネ
    • ・寄付お願いします
      YENTEN:YYzNPzdsZWqr5THWAdMrKDj7GT8ietDc2W
      BitZenny:ZfpUbVya8MWQkjjGJMjA7P9pPkqaLnwPWH
      c0ban:8KG95GXdEquNpPW8xJAJf7nn5kbimQ5wj1
      Skycoin:KMqcn7x8REwwzMHPi9fV9fbNwdofYAWKRo

    cocos2d-x のCCStringToStringDictionary

    なぜかTilemapのチュートリアルが最新のcocos2d-xで、「CCStringToStringDictionary」が動かない。

    CCMutableArray, CCArray, CCMutalbeDictionaryが嫌いなのでCCStringToStringDictionaryをtypedefで定義とあるが書き方分からない。
    URL:http://www.cocos2d-x.org/boards/6/topics/1767

    Tilemapのチュートリアルのコードには、libs/cocos2dx/include/CCMutableDictionary.hの最後の方にあった。

    #define CCDictionary	CCMutableDictionary
    typedef CCDictionary<std::string, CCString*> CCStringToStringDictionary;
    }//namespace   cocos2d 
    

    →しかし、CCMutableDictionaryは2.xで非推奨だ
    理由の参考URL:http://www.cocos2d-x.org/projects/cocos2d-x/wiki/Cocos2d-x_v20_migration_guide?version=38

    ・旧 → 新
    CCMutableDictionary → CCDictionary
    CCMutableArray →  CCArray instead.